These days, all I feel is loneliness, and I lack the motivation to make my life better.

I believe that every small decision in my daily life leads me into this endless loop of emptiness. I constantly find myself seeking some company, yet at the same time, I try to avoid many people. I don’t know how long this will last. Most of the time, I feel all alone, yet I lack the courage to go outside and face the world like I used to. Ironically, whenever I fall asleep, I always have a similar dream where I find myself out in the wild with some company that I can never remember who or how they looked.

As I lay in bed, trying to make sense of these conflicting emotions, I realize that I need to find a way to break free from this cycle of isolation and self-imposed seclusion. It’s become clear that the key to overcoming this overwhelming sense of loneliness lies in finding the right balance between seeking companionship and cherishing moments of solitude.

I know it won’t be easy, but I’m determined to take small steps towards reconnecting with the world around me. Perhaps starting with a short walk in the park, or attending a local event that piques my interest. It’s time to summon the courage to step out of my comfort zone.

In the midst of this journey, I find solace in knowing that I’m not alone in my struggles. Many others have faced similar challenges and have managed to emerge stronger and more resilient. Their stories serve as a beacon of hope, reminding me that it is possible to overcome this feeling of emptiness.

As for those mysterious companions in my dreams, perhaps they symbolize the potential connections that await me in the real world. It’s a sign that there are people out there, just waiting to be discovered, who could become an integral part of my life.

So, here’s to embracing change and seeking out the company and experiences that have the power to enrich my life. It’s time to turn the page and step into a new chapter filled with hope, growth, and meaningful connections.
